4. INSTALLATION 

4.1 Mounting 

Mounting considerations 

The IB-782 can be mounted on a desk or on a bulkhead. Keep the following points in mind 
when selecting a mounting location: 

• 

Leave sufficient space around the unit for maintenance and servicing. 

• 

Locate the unit away from direct sunlight because heat can build up inside the cabinet. 

• 

Install the unit near the telephone or facsimile which is to be connected. 

• 

The mounting location should be stable and moderate in temperature and humidity. 

• 

Locate the unit away from areas subject to rain and water splash. 

 

Mounting procedure 

Fix the unit to the mounting location with four tapping screws (supplied).
